KU is excited to offer the LEAD: Legal Education Accelerated Degree Program. This innovative 3+3 program allows KU students to earn a B.A. and a J.D. in six years instead of seven. Be guaranteed admission to KU Law after your junior year, provided that you meet the admission requirements. Alumni Services. KU Law alumni have access to services, resources, information and events. As a KU Law graduate, you are entitled to a variety of benefits, from career services to library access. Alumni are invited to social and professional events throughout the year. KU Law’s alumni directory connects you with more than 8,000 fellow graduates. Aug 23, 2016 · Each hour of field-placement credit requires 42.5 hours of field-placement work during the semester or summer session in which the student is enrolled in the course. Thus, a student enrolled for 3 credit hours must work 127.5 hours over the semester or summer session. Students will be required to spend additional time on academic work as ... We encourage other faculty, students and the public to come in and explore the accomplishments of the University of Kansas School of Law faculty.In Missouri, 100% of KU Law graduates who took the Missouri bar exam for the first time in 2021 passed. KU Law’s 100% pass rate was 17.8% above the Missouri average of 82.2% for first-time test takers. In Kansas, 98.2% of KU Law first-time test takers passed the Kansas bar exam in 2021, placing the school 20.4% above the Kansas average.

Nostalgic law students who spent their first two years in "old" Green Hall and moved to a new building in the fall of 1977 persuaded Professor Paul Wilson to lead them back to their original home.
